One of the easiest and best ways to get people to your Facebook business page is to funnel them from the ‘About’ section on your personal Facebook profile. You can edit it so that your business page links directly from your personal page.  (It’s MUCH better than linking to your company’s corporate page…if you send people there you’ll lose a potential customer.)

To link to your Facebook business page from your personal profile, follow these steps or watch the video tutorial here:

  1. Click your Name in the top-right corner of any page on Facebook.
  2. Click the About link below your picture.
    The About page appears.

  3. Click Work and Education from the Overview menu on the left side.
    The Work, Skills, and Eduction sections appear.
  4. Click the Add a workplace link.
    The Workplace form appears.

  5. Type the name of your new business page in the Company field.
    Note: When you see the page name appear in the suggestions, click it to add it to the Company field.
  6. Type your position, city/town, and a description in the appropriate fields.
  7. Select the desired date from the Time Period fields.
  8. Click the Save Changes button, when finished.
    Go back to your About page to view the link to your Facebook business page.

If you have more than one business page or workplace, repeat the above steps.
